Hard liquors like vodka, rum, tequila, and whiskey; most liqueurs, including Campari, St. Germain, Cointreau, and Pimm's; and bitters are perfectly safe to store at room temperature. The answer to that question is a matter of quality, not safety, assuming proper storage conditions - when properly stored, a bottle of orange liqueur has an indefinite shelf life, even after it has been opened. Depending on the amount of air in the bottle, liqueurs such as curacao and schnapps may survive many years after being opened, however this is not guaranteed. Blue Curaao Curaao is a Caribbean liqueur made using the dried peel of the Laraha citrus fruit.
